Am I crazy? 9060xt vs 9070xt by lNalRlKoTiX in radeon

[–]Vidyamancer 0 points1 point  (0 children)

  1. Switching from a 9060XT to a 9070XT won't affect "image quality" under the same settings. Medium on a 9060XT is going to look identical to medium on a 9070XT.
  2. Load times are not affected by your GPU. These are affected by your storage device, CPU and the game's optimization (whether it's optimized to use multiple threads for shader pre-caching or not). You can have the best SSD and CPU in the world and still be plagued by long loading screens depending on the game.
  3. Your CPU is ancient and is holding the 9070XT back massively. If one of your CPU cores is pegged at 100% load with a 9060XT, you will have the exact same FPS on a 9070XT and possibly even lower FPS on an RTX 5090 due to driver overhead.

I'm about to give up by SonyHell in radeon

[–]Vidyamancer 0 points1 point  (0 children)

You need a full Windows re-install.

Aside from shader cache folders being littered all over the place, any game you installed with the NVIDIA GPU is going to leave config files around with optimizations for that NVIDIA GPU ID. If you uninstall a game normally, these config files will still be left behind, even when you re-install the game. They are often write-protected as well on first launch.

If you don't want to re-install Windows, you have to use REVOUninstaller or a similar tool to remove everything related to the game and also manually check LocalData/Local/Roaming/Public Documents/Documents etc. for leftover files. Often they're named after the game's developer or publisher.

Lately a lot of games with cloud sync have started syncing these god-forsaken config files even after a complete Windows re-install, especially on subscription services such as Xbox Game Pass & EA Play. The first time you launch a game, the config is made and it gets overwritten by the cloud even if you manually attempt to change the "GPU_ID=" line with the binary data for your GPU. AMD claims DDR5-4800 is within 1% FPS difference of DDR5-6000 on Ryzen 7 9850X3D by RenatsMC in Amd

[–]Vidyamancer 1 point2 points  (0 children)

Cherry-picked single-player games at 4K? Sure, I'll buy the ~1% number.

CPU heavy multiplayer games (WoW, Star Citizen, Escape from Tarkov etc.) at 4800C40 vs. 6000C28 tuned? Around 20% higher average framerate and ~20-40% higher 1% lows. Massively superior stutter-free experience, even with X3D chips.

5070 TI & 7800X3D Build by [deleted] in nvidia

[–]Vidyamancer 0 points1 point  (0 children)

I had the RM850i which came with a better fan and Corsair Link. It tested OK with a PSU tester but still fried GPUs at random during heavy loads (going from Cyberpunk cutscene to rendering world again, entering large city hub in WoW etc). PC would click and power off, then upon reboot the GPUs would be dead.

These old PSUs are not certified to handle the large transient spikes of modern GPU architectures.
